Output 3d1ce88a6000f14f8a59b2238bfe0ee2035febf3eb7425504396a52d218b9849:1

value
314514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a398070612536952dbcd750dc6a91ea3f5c5fa5 OP_EQUAL
address
3QW5jnoeABdUDMuJEx2CQ5xyoBjJgWUGJY
transaction
3d1ce88a6000f14f8a59b2238bfe0ee2035febf3eb7425504396a52d218b9849
spent
true